I'm looking for information on 1985 & 1989 Bordeaux. More specifically: I was recently given a bottle each of 1985 and 1989 Domaine de la Gaffeliere St. Emilion, and I'm wondering what their value is, and whether they'd be best consumed soon, or saved. Any general information on either vintage would also be appreciated.


- winecollector - 10-12-2001

Hi millenatasha, and welcome. The wine you have- if it was stored properly, should make for a nice drinker. The 85' has likely already peaked.... and the 89' is probably either at or approaching peak. As far as value, neither one is worth much, likely $50 or less. If you decide to open them, I suggest decanting the 89'. The 85' will likely be fruiter and less concentrated than the 89', typical of St. Emilion. Hope this helps.
